Liz Callaway, Mary Testa and More Set for BROADWAY CLOSE UP Series
by Nicole Rosky - Aug 10, 2012


For 12 years, Merkin Concert Hall's Broadway Close Up series has been taking audiences behind the scenes of classic musicals old and new with eye-opening interviews and inspiring performances. Jones, Schmidt to Make Special Appearance at Merkin Concert Hall's Broadway Playhouse, 3/6
by BWW News Desk - Mar 6, 2011


Directed by Sean Hartley, Merkin Concert Hall's Broadway Playhouse concerts introduce New York's next generation of musical theater fans age 4-11 to some of the greatest Broadway musicals of all time. The 2011 Broadway Playhouse series concludes with the musicals of Tom Jones and Harvey Schmidt, creators of The Fantasticks, 110 in the Shade and I Do! I Do!
